    I've been tracking this food truck for almost a month, waiting for the perfect location and time to try them. They finally came close to my area, and I got to try them at Cranes Roost Park. They're a good truck that travels around. You can find their schedule on Insta. They had a long line and the wait was pretty substantial for a food truck, but we'll worth the wait. I got the Harley fries, which I was super excited to try. It's perfect! The fries and shrimp were perfectly crispy, even with a generous amount of sauces, which were very delicious!! I'll be keeping an eye out for them being in my area again!

    Brappin Crabs, has made their way From the 667 to the 407!! This couple brought their talents & vibes from Maryland to Orlando with one of the newest & Hottest food trucks in town Serving some of the best seafood !! I ordered the Salmon Cheesesteak Egg roll , (Blackened salmon with peppers, onions, and provolone cheese in an egg roll topped with Honey Garlic sauce paired with fries), A single crab cluster ( 1 single Crab cluster with Brapp Sauce) , & the Harley Fries , (Honey Garlic Fried Shrimp Over Cheesy fries) Catch them if you can . They sell out fast so follow them on IG and find out where they are popping up next and I strongly suggest you ORDER ONLINE AHEAD of time . When you order online you will be given a time your order will be ready. They are also cashless, the food is delicious & the customer service is great!

    Taste: (9/10) The Fried Salmon Bites are REALLY GOOD! Their salmon don't taste "fishy" and pairs very well with the breading and the "sauce" that they put on it. The down side is the fries. I didn't care for them. Appearance: (10/10) Look at the photo! It was presented well and look delectable! Value: (8/10) This combo was $30. For salmon, that's understandable. General Comment: I truly wasn't disappointed with the Fried Salmon Bites! If they had the option for the Fried Salmon Bites, by themselves, I would definitely purchase that order. I'm particular about my fries and unfortunately it did not meet the standards of my personal taste. I'll pass on them. But you may very well love their fries, so I still recommend you trying the combo and have a taste for yourself!
